The Opportunity at Hand
In the global higher education landscape, we are witnessing a transformation unlike any in recent decades. The traditional models of funding, delivery, and regulation are under strain. Private higher education providers, investors, and institutional leaders are all seeking ways to partner, adapt, and scale in order to stay resilient.
At Plethro, we believe the UK—and more broadly, Europe and the Middle East—represents a frontier of opportunity:
- Under-addressed niches of demand — specialized vocational, microcredentials, lifelong learning, hybrid modes of delivery.
- Cross-border expansion potential — leveraging UK regulatory frameworks and quality reputation to reach new markets.
- Consolidation and capital aggregation — many smaller institutions have compelling assets (faculty, niche programs, regulatory accreditation) but lack scale or capital to invest in growth.
- Catalysts of change — regulatory reform, student demand shifts, public-private partnerships — all create room for new models to emerge.
But capturing that opportunity requires more than ambition. It demands precision, trust, and deep sector insight.
